
DEADZONE is a multiplayer survival modpack within an apocalyptic world. The modpack is played in adventure mode and the experience is carefully crafted to promote PVP and PVE. Find settlements, gather loot and weapons, and find your way into the safezones.
- OFFICIAL SERVERS. DEADZONE runs two official servers using its custom map. Currently, US and EU servers are available, sponsored by Bisect Hosting.
- OFFICIAL MAP. ZAREVYN is a massive 7000x7000 map built for DEADZONE by Zephyrusjz.

THE MAP
Zarevyn is an abandoned region left behind after a sudden collapse. Leftover loot from the civilian population is scattered around, while police stations and military bases hold the most valuable weapons for survival.

CREDITS
ABOUT THE MAP: "ZAREVYN" was built by Zephyrusjz, who co-authors this modpack. Their map is licenced as ARR. Trees within the map were made by lentebriesje and rocks were made by bidule995.
FAQ
Can I play in singleplayer?
Singleplayer is not supported, we recommend you to check out our official servers, or other public servers that may be created in the future.
When will you update X mod?
Updates will come regularly but please refrain from asking for ETAs.
Where can I download the Zarevyn map?
The map may be provided in the future by Zephyrusjz.
